Well Naples is not exactly the Mexican food capital of the world, you know. Actually I love the food, plain and simple but quite authentic at The Hammock. It's a little place on Goodlette Road, just north of Fifth Avenue. On the left going north, sort of in front and beyond the huge, but almost derelict Grand Central Station complex.
A lot of people love Flaco's on the north trail. I love their salsa and chips, but after that everything I've gotten there tastes the same.
I've not yet been to Cilantro Tamales, on 41 north in a strip shopping center right across from P.F. Changs. I've tried twice but P. F. Changs always calls to me first. Friends love Cilantro Tamales, though.

If your travels ever take you to Fort Myers, we have a really superb Mexican restaurant on the Bell Tower shopping grounds. Cantina Laredo is a lovely restaurant and its owner/manager said they aspire for it to be like a 4* restaurant in Mexico City. They prepare the guacamole table side like the old traditional preparation of a ceasar salad.

They do a great Snapper Vera Cruz and the best Chile Rellenos with picadillo filling. It is by far the best mexican restaurant I have encountered in Florida. LMF
